VirtualBox ubuntu 自动挂载共享文件夹

本文介绍如何在Ubuntu虚拟机环境下实现主机与虚拟机之间的文件夹共享,并通过配置/etc/rc.local文件达到开机自动挂载的效果。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

sunmoonsh 写道:
weixueke@126.com 写道:
win7系统下,用Oracle VM VirtualBox虚拟安装了ubuntu 12.04。安装了增强功能包(Guest Additions)后,在Oracle VM VirtualBox的设置页面,设置了共享,如下图
附件:
sshot-1.png

在ubuntu的终端,执行
代码:
sudo mkdir /mnt/share
sudo mount -t vboxsf router /mnt/share

将router文件夹挂载到了mnt/share目录下。
不想每次开机都要重新挂载,如是修改了etc/fstab文件,添加
代码:
sharing /mnt/share vboxsf rw,gid=100,uid=1000,auto 0 0

但是ubuntu重启后,每次还是得手动挂载。请大家指点一下!


大部分网络资料都是说在 /etc/fstab 文件中追加 
VirtualBox虚拟机文件夹共享挂载命令 “ sharing /mnt/share vboxsf defaults 0 0 ”,其实是错误的,
因为系统调用fstab的时候,Virtualbox的共享目录的模块还没有加载,所以每次加载都会失败,最终的解决方案如下:
在文件 /etc/rc.local 中(用root用户)追加如下命令
mount -t vboxsf sharing /mnt/share

最后重启系统.


使用这种方式成功.
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值